Oh Joy! I'm typing this on a real computer tonight, so things will be capitalized and spelled correctly, but still no pictures. I noticed yesterday evening when I was riding the last 8 miles that I was getting a really bumpy ride. When I checked my back tire this morning, it was extremely low on air. So I pumped it up and got going. It held for the day. Today was to be 48 miles, but with two nasty uphills, one on a road for no shoulders. I weighed my options. I could take all day riding the 48, come into the hotel late and be totally exhausted. Or I could bump a ride with the van after 24 and then have time to ride around the mining town of Globe and visit an archaelogical dig of an old Native-American pueblo. I chose the latter, as did one other woman. The other ladies all did great and were proud that they made it up the hill, but that wasn't the kind of ride I wanted to do. As it was, we climbed 4 miles through the Queen Valley and it was beautiful. I didn't have to push. I just got off every once in awhile and rested. We stopped at the Buckboard City Restaurant in Superior. I had a cinnamon roll with melted butter to die for! That's where Helen and I got into the van. By the time we got to the hotel in the van, the first riders were already coming in. We have some fast people in our group. We've been so lucky with the weather. The top temperature today was only about 79. It should be about the same tomorrow. It will be a 78 mile day with a mixture of small hills and flats. I'm certainly going to try it. We all went out to eat tonight. Some went to a Mexican reataurant (me included) and the others went to Papa John's. I think I'm finally getting a little weary of Mexican food.
